thanks for the reply! do you have a favorite pan set? i'm not too fond of the one i've been using.
I just got a Sakura Koi sketch set about a month ago that I really love but it cost me around $20US ( I also highly recommend their water brushes if you are on the go a lot, their sketch sets come with one but you can buy them individually for about $8US).
The only problem I’ve had with this set is the Prussian blue seems to be prone to drying with a hard edge that bugs me to death and that again the pans are rather small if you plan on doing large washes and pieces.
I also highly recommend these. They were the ones that got me into doing traditional art again. They work really well for how cheap they are. Really beautiful colors and there is actually a set that has bigger pans for large washes (less colors than the linked set for a little more though).
However if you layer a lot of paint on paper that isn’t specifically for watercolor it can become chalky and smear slightly. So they aren’t exactly archival but they work fine if your scanning/photographing your pieces for online sites and print making. I also recommend buying them in-store at Micheal’s just because they go for about $8-9US instead of $11.
